How can i set the Network Folder. In Zetadocs Settings i have to set http... or https...
Can't i set a Folder beginning with \\....
*This post is locked for comments
Hi Peter,
Please refer to section 3.3 (step 4) of the Zetadocs Express Installation Guide for info on how to specify the Zetadocs Archive Service Address.
Please be aware that you are not specifying a folder location on the Zetadocs General Settings page, instead you specify the service address. This service address will include the server name that you have installed the Zetadocs Archive Service on (http://<servername>/ZetadocsArchive). This web service is responsive to manage the archiving and retrieval from the shared network folder (which must be called "Zetadocs Archive").

Hi guna,
I am facing the same problem. I can upload the file to the Zetadocs Archive folder , but when i try to open the file, it return to me an intranet url. Therefore, i got an error.
I have make sure that the zetadocs general setting has been set to
http://<ip public>/ZetadocsArchive (the NAV is installed on Azure VM).
can you point me where i need to do the url modification ?
thanks.
Hi Hery
You need to modify Name - OnDrillDown() on Zetadocs Web Rel. Docs. Page (9041211). I reckon this issue happens when server address is changed after the initial configuration.
